The figure shows a rubber cuboid that measures 106 m by 23 m by 23 m.
- Find the maximum number of 9-m cubes that can be cut from the rubber cuboid.
- Find the total surface area of the L-shaped block after cutting.
(a)
Number of cubes along the length
= 106 ÷ 9
= 11 r 7
Breath = Height
Number of cubes along the breadth or height
= 23 ÷ 9
= 2 r 5
Maximum number of 9 m cubes
= 11 x 2 x 2
= 44
